What is Electric Double Layer Capacitor (EDLC)?

A double layer of Helmholtz layers is formed at the interface of electrode / electrolyte. This serves as dielectric between the two, and forms a capacitor. Similar capacitor is formed at the second electrode as well. Combination of these two capacitors in series go to form the overall capacitance.

What is a multi layer ceramic capacitor?

The most common design of a ceramic capacitor is the multi layer construction where the capacitor elements are stacked, so called MLCC (Multi Layer Ceramic Capacitor). The number of layers has to be limited for reasons of the manufacturing technique. The upper limit amounts at present to over 1000. Besides economical reasons come into play.

What is a single layer ceramic capacitor (SLCC)?

In the same way the Single Layer Ceramic Capacitor (SLCC or just SLC) consists of one dielectric layer. The ceramic is covered with an adhesive layer of, for example, chrome nickel as a base for copper electrodes. On the electrodes leads are soldered as shown in the principle Figure 5., before the component is encapsulated in lacquer or epoxy.

What is high-k dielectric stack Engineering in fabrication of MIM capacitor?

High-k dielectric stack engineering in fabrication of MIM capacitor was used to address these issues. Usually, a thin barrier layer of large bandgap dielectric material (Al2O 3, SiO 2) is stacked with very high dielectric constant material (ZrO 2, TiO and HfO 2).

What is MIM capacitor?

After replacing the top and bottom layers with metal electrodes, this was called as Metal-Insulator-Metal Capacitors. This capacitor was used to mitigate the disadvantage of PIP capacitors. A MIM capacitor has a structure in which a lower metal, an insulating layer and an upper metal are laminated, in that order.
